Baptisia tinctorian
Baptisia tinctoria
SORE, HEAVY, ACHING MUSCLES; gall-bladder, heart, etc WITH RAPID PROSTRATION; the bed is too hard, yet he feels too sick to move. Dark; mucous membranes, exudates, haemorrhage, stools, spots in body, etc. Brown; sordes, stripe down center of tongue, stool, menses, etc. FOUL; odor of body; excretions, stool, sweat, etc. Grippe. Zymoses. Sepsis. Typhoid states. Bed sores, etc. Insensible to pain. Restless mind but lifeless body. Bewildered. Thick speech. Sensation as of a blow on occiput. Dull, drowsy, besotted look. SENSE OF DUALITY; PARTS FEEL SCATTERED ABOUT, SEPARATED, numb or too large. Dull and confused. Falls asleep while answering or does not complete his sentence. Eyes feel swelled. DUSKY, SODDEN, BESOTTED, STUPID COUNTENANCE. Dark red, tumid mouth and throat. Throat, numb inside but sensitive outside. Fetor oris. Tongue cracked, bleeds, feels thick or is heavily coated. Viscid saliva. Aphthae. Ragged ulcers in throat. Can't swallow solids. Spasm of gullet. Easy vomiting. Diarrhoea; sudden; horribly foul, mushy, painless, dark or slaty. Symptoms radiate from small of back. Dyspnoea from weakness in chest. Air hunger; on waking, > standing. Bronchial asthma. Drowsy, stupid and languid; slides down in bed and lower jaw drops (Mur-ac.). Hyperpyrexia. Livid spots on body. Uraemia.
Region: BLOOD; Mind; Nerves; Mucous membranes, Digestive tract; Left side.
Worse: Humid heat; Fogs; In room; Pressure; On awaking.
